Well, I hauled my headlight bucket and guages off my 1982 GS 750E to paint and when I put it all back together my left signal light refused to flash. At first I thought it was just a ground problem but my right signal flashes and they are connected to the same ground. Now I've tried everything I could think of, checked wire connection, possible wire breaks but to no avail. If anyone could help me out or supply a wiring diagram for the bike to aid in the wire tracing it would be much apreciated. Oh and the rear signal on the same side(left) doesen't even light up! the light isn't burnt out, I checked and also reversed the wires so when I signaled right my left would flash.. AND IT DID! So I'm pretty stumped to what the problem might be. Any help would be great.
